
在Excel表格中给每个单元格内容加逗号,可以通过以下几种方法来实现:使用公式、使用VBA代码、批量编辑功能。 其中,最方便和常用的方法是使用公式进行批量处理。下面我们将详细介绍这几种方法,并提供实际操作步骤和注意事项。
一、使用公式添加逗号
在Excel中,使用公式是最常见和便捷的方法之一,通过简单的函数可以快速实现给每个单元格内容添加逗号的操作。
1、使用CONCATENATE函数
Excel中的CONCATENATE函数可以将多个字符串连接在一起。假设我们要在A列的每个单元格内容后面加上逗号,可以使用以下步骤:
- 在B1单元格中输入公式:
=CONCATENATE(A1, ",")。 - 按Enter键确认。
- 将B1单元格的公式向下拖动,填充到其他单元格。
这种方法的优点是简单直观,适合处理小规模数据。
2、使用&符号
与CONCATENATE函数类似,&符号也可以用来连接字符串。具体操作步骤如下:
- 在B1单元格中输入公式:
=A1 & ","。 - 按Enter键确认。
- 将B1单元格的公式向下拖动,填充到其他单元格。
这种方法与使用CONCATENATE函数的效果相同,但语法更简洁,适合快速操作。
3、使用TEXTJOIN函数
对于较新的Excel版本,可以使用TEXTJOIN函数,将多个单元格内容连接在一起并添加指定的分隔符。具体步骤如下:
- 在B1单元格中输入公式:
=TEXTJOIN(",", TRUE, A1:A10)。 - 按Enter键确认。
这种方法适用于处理连续的多个单元格内容,并将它们统一添加逗号。
二、使用VBA代码添加逗号
对于需要处理大量数据或需要更高效操作的用户,使用VBA代码是一个不错的选择。下面介绍如何通过VBA代码来给每个单元格内容添加逗号。
1、打开VBA编辑器
- 按下Alt + F11键,打开Excel的VBA编辑器。
- 在VBA编辑器中,点击“插入”菜单,选择“模块”。
2、输入VBA代码
在模块窗口中输入以下代码:
Sub AddComma()
Dim rng As Range
Dim cell As Range
' 选择需要处理的单元格范围
Set rng = Selection
' 遍历每个单元格并添加逗号
For Each cell In rng
cell.Value = cell.Value & ","
Next cell
End Sub
3、运行VBA代码
- 回到Excel工作表,选择需要处理的单元格范围。
- 按下Alt + F8键,打开宏对话框,选择“AddComma”宏并运行。
这种方法适合处理大规模数据,并且可以灵活调整代码以满足不同需求。
三、批量编辑功能
Excel还提供了一些批量编辑功能,可以通过查找和替换等操作来实现给每个单元格内容添加逗号的目的。
1、使用查找和替换功能
- 选择需要处理的单元格范围。
- 按下Ctrl + H键,打开查找和替换对话框。
- 在“查找内容”框中输入“*”(表示任意字符)。
- 在“替换为”框中输入“&,”(表示在每个单元格内容后加逗号)。
- 点击“替换全部”按钮。
这种方法虽然不如公式和VBA代码灵活,但在处理简单的需求时非常高效。
四、总结
在Excel表格中给每个单元格内容加逗号的方法有多种,选择合适的方法可以提高工作效率。使用公式、使用VBA代码、批量编辑功能,每种方法都有其优点和适用场景。对于简单的数据处理,可以选择使用公式或批量编辑功能;对于复杂的需求,建议使用VBA代码实现。
通过以上介绍,相信你已经掌握了如何在Excel表格中给每个单元格内容添加逗号的方法。在实际操作中,可以根据具体需求选择最适合的方法,以提高工作效率和处理精度。
相关问答FAQs:
1. 如何在Excel表格中给每个单元格添加逗号?
- 问题描述:如何在Excel中为每个单元格添加逗号分隔符?
- 回答:在Excel中,您可以使用以下步骤为每个单元格添加逗号:
- 选中您想要添加逗号的单元格或者选择包含您想要添加逗号的整个列。
- 在Excel的顶部菜单栏中选择“开始”选项卡。
- 在“数字”组中,找到“逗号样式”按钮。点击该按钮,Excel会自动为所选单元格添加逗号分隔符。
- 如果您想要自定义逗号的样式,可以点击“数值格式”按钮旁边的下拉箭头,然后选择“自定义”选项。在弹出的对话框中,您可以设置逗号的位置和其他格式选项。
2. 怎样在Excel中为每个表格单元格添加逗号?
- 问题描述:我想在Excel表格中的每个单元格后面加上逗号,如何实现?
- 回答:要为Excel表格中的每个单元格添加逗号,请按照以下步骤操作:
- 首先,选择您想要添加逗号的单元格范围,或者选择整列。
- 在Excel的顶部菜单栏中,点击“开始”选项卡。
- 在“数字”组中,找到“逗号样式”按钮,并点击它。这将自动为选定的单元格添加逗号分隔符。
- 如果您需要自定义逗号的样式,您可以点击“数字格式”按钮旁边的下拉箭头,然后选择“自定义”选项。在弹出的对话框中,您可以设置逗号的位置和其他格式选项。
3. 如何在Excel表格中为每个单元格加上逗号分隔符?
- 问题描述:我想将Excel表格中的每个单元格都添加逗号分隔符,有什么方法可以实现吗?
- 回答:在Excel中为每个单元格添加逗号分隔符,您可以按照以下步骤进行操作:
- 首先,选中您想要添加逗号分隔符的单元格范围,或者选择整列。
- 在Excel顶部菜单栏中,点击“开始”选项卡。
- 在“数字”组中,找到“逗号样式”按钮,并点击它。这将为选定的单元格自动添加逗号分隔符。
- 如果您需要自定义逗号的样式,您可以点击“数字格式”按钮旁边的下拉箭头,然后选择“自定义”选项。在弹出的对话框中,您可以设置逗号的位置和其他格式选项。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4742383